From 28683f7dacd94801e9a0d4b28e5aa8a700fc3d6f Mon Sep 17 00:00:00 2001 From: Cassidy Burden Date: Mon, 25 Jul 2016 11:23:13 -0700 Subject: binary search tool: Add compiler wrapper for Android bisection Add compiler wrapper similar to ChromeOS object bisector's compiler wrapper. bisect_driver.py is a modified version of bisect.py from the ChromeOS sysroot_wrapper. compiler_wrapper.py is a simple skeleton script used to invoke bisect_driver, and it is meant to be replaced by a more robust compiler wrapper.
